The University of San Diego School of Leadership and Education Sciences (SOLES) offers graduate programs in education, counseling, therapy, leadership, nonprofit management, and more. Our graduate students include working professionals advancing in their fields, new graduates preparing to begin their careers, and returning students discovering new possibilities.
